WebA scatterplot displays a relationship between two sets of data. A scatterplot can also be called a scattergram or a scatter diagram. In a scatterplot, a dot represents a single data point. With several data points graphed, a visual distribution of the data can be seen. Depending on how tightly the points cluster together, you may be able to ... WebA scatterplot is a type of data display that shows the relationship between two numerical variables. Each member of the dataset gets plotted as a point whose (x, y) (x,y) coordinates relates to its values for the two variables. For example, here is a scatterplot that shows …

WebPurpose: Check for Relationship. A scatter plot ( Chambers 1983) reveals relationships or association between two variables. Such relationships manifest themselves by any non-random structure in the plot. Various common types of patterns are demonstrated in the examples .
